Specifications

Frameset

Fork
Gain OMR carbon fork, 700x35 maximun tyre, flat mount disc mount, 12x100mm Thru Axle
Frame
Orbea Gain Carbon OMR monocoque structure, Integrated Seat clamp with STVZO light, ICR cable routing, Thru Axle 12x142mm rear, thread M12x2 P1, Flat Mount disc, 700x35 max tyre, BB386 EVO, Mahle X20 AMC plug.

Drivetrain

Groupset
Shimano 105
Cassette
Shimano 105 R7100 11-34t 12-Speed
Chain
Shimano M7100
Crankset
Shimano 105 R7100 34x50t
Front Derailleur
Shimano 105 Di2 R7150
Rear Derailleur
Shimano 105 Di2 R7150
Shifters
Shimano Di2 R7170

Brakes

Brakes
Shimano R7170 Hydraulic Disc

Cockpit

Handlebar
OC Road Performance RP20 Alu SL, Reach 80, Drop 125
Headset
FSA 1-1/2" Integrated Aluminium Cup
Saddle
Fizik Aliante R5
Seatpost
Carbon, 27.2mm, Setback 20
Stem
OC Road Performance RP10, -8º

Wheels & Tires

Axles
Front: Orbea Thru Axle 12x100mm M12x2 P1 Lite , Rear: Orbea Thru Axle 12x142mm M12x2 P1 Lite
Front Tire
Pirelli P ZERO™ Race TLR 700x30c
Rear Tire
Pirelli P ZERO™ Race TLR 700x30c
Wheel Set
Alloy, Tubeless, 700c, 21c

Pedals

Pedals
Sold separately

E-System

Battery
Mahle iX350 36V 353Wh
Charger
Mahle Active Charger up to 4A
Controller/Display
Mahle Pulsar One monochrome ANT+ LEV
Motor
Mahle motor hub X20, ALC

Accessories

Accessories & Extras
Remote: Mahle ONE Head Unit (BT/ANT+) , Mahle Handlebar Dual eShifter

What to check when buying used

Inspection

Frame condition

Inspect the frame, fork, welds, and high-stress areas for cracks, dents, or prior repairs.

Inspection

Drivetrain wear

Check chain stretch, cassette teeth, chainrings, and shifting under load before negotiating price.

Inspection

Wheel condition

Inspect rims, hubs, spokes, and bearing play; ask about the tire age and any prior wheel rebuilds.

Inspection

Service history

Ask for service records covering bearings, brakes, drivetrain, and any frame or fork warranty work.

Inspection

Battery health

Request battery cycle count and any diagnostic report; older packs lose range and capacity.

Inspection

Motor warranty

Verify motor warranty status and any firmware updates from the manufacturer dealer.
